stamen Floral organ producing pollen and typically composed of a filament and an anther.

stamen the male reproductive parts of a flower. It consists of the filament and the anther.

stamen male structure of a flower, composed of an anther, bearing pollen, and a filament, or stalk (see also pollen).

stamen Male reproductive structure in flowers; consist of a stalklike filament with a pollen-producing anther at its tip.

stamen This is the male reproductive organ of a plant, located in the androecium of the flower. It has two components: the filament and the anther. See complete flower.
